Pilāni, situated in the Jhunjhunu district of Rajasthan, India, is a small town primarily known for the prestigious Birla Institute of Technology and Science (BITS Pilani). This educational hub attracts students from across the country, offering a serene environment conducive to learning. Despite its small size, Pilāni holds a significant place in India's educational landscape, making it a unique destination for those interested in academia. The town's location in Rajasthan also provides access to the state's rich cultural heritage.
